HB4105

 

Introduced 9/3/2021, by Rep. Tom Demmer, Sam Yingling, Andrew S. Chesney and Tony McCombie

 

SYNOPSIS AS INTRODUCED:
 
625 ILCS 5/3-405.2  from Ch. 95 1/2, par. 3-405.2

    Amends the Illinois Vehicle Code. Provides that the Secretary of State shall not issue any license plate or digital license plate that has installed or attached thereto a global positioning system.

7    Sec. 3-405.2. Improper plates.
8    (a) The Secretary of State shall refuse to issue any
9license plates bearing a combination of letters or numbers, or
10both, which creates a potential duplication or, in the opinion
11of the Secretary, (1) would substantially interfere with plate
12identification for law enforcement purposes, (2) is
13misleading, or (3) creates a connotation that is offensive to
14good taste and decency.
15    (b) The Secretary of State shall not issue any license
16plate or digital license plate that has installed or attached
17thereto a global positioning system.
18    (c) The Secretary may revoke any such plates described in
19subsection (a) or (b) issued previously. Any person who has
20his or her plates revoked under this Section may acquire at no
21charge new plates and any required stickers of the same
22category and for the same period of registration.
